Understanding Your AML Report: Key Metrics & Insights

Deciphering your Anti-Money Laundering (AML) documentation can feel overwhelming , but understanding the crucial data points provides essential views into your organization's regulatory position . Here's explore some primary areas to focus on . A common AML report will frequently include details related to:

  • Suspicious Activity Counts : Track the number of events flagged as suspicious.

  • False Positive Levels: Analyze how many warnings were wrongly triggered and pinpoint ways to lessen these.

  • Transaction Monitoring Effectiveness: Gauge the efficiency of your tools in detecting potential illicit activity.

  • Customer Verification Scores: Examine the threat ratings assigned to your users.

  • Sanctions Matching Results: Verify precise matching against prohibited lists.

With methodically reviewing these elements , you can better comprehend your AML initiative's performance and implement necessary actions to reduce vulnerability.

Decoding the Financial Crime Document : What Do the Numbers Indicate ?

Navigating an financial crime document can feel like cracking a difficult code. The numbers presented aren't always clear, and a thorough assessment is crucial for ensuring compliance . Let's examine some common metrics you might encounter . Essentially , the report aims to demonstrate potential dangers related to suspicious activity. A elevated Transaction Amount doesn't automatically signify criminal activity, but it warrants additional scrutiny . Similarly, an increased count of flags triggered by your system requires prompt intervention. Consider these points:

  • Payment Volume : A sudden rise might point to potential fraud .
  • Count of Matches : More notifications typically require increased attention .
  • Country Danger Scores: Different areas carry varying levels of monetary danger .

Remember that the document is a instrument to assist your financial crime programs, not a definitive determination. Always consult with qualified specialists for a complete grasp of your specific scenario.
